HOW can u tell if the hip going to last if only after 6 months i have clunks squeaky but i am scared to back to the doc i doint know why im because i have to do the other one . i have watched the video on line but were i live no one that i know has these problems . i read your threads and it helps me understand alittle .is there other things i should xpect ,but u know the pain is alot less :sct:im happy that i did do the op because i do more now than before.
 
If you watched the video, you'll know it's not an uncommon thing but the statistics are such that it's highly unlikely you'd ever meet anyone in the same boat. Even surgeons don't see that many but it does happen. And it has little or no significance over all, especially not on the wear of the prosthesis. Generally, the evidence is that they can last around 20 or even 30 years, all being well. But no-one can say for sure on each individual hip.

I'm glad you are happy with your new hip. What type do you have? I know some types tend to squeak more than others. Ceramic on ceramic for instance.
The most important thing is the pain relief in my mind. Glad you have achieved that. You still have more time for healing as well and getting the hip muslcels stronger. I found the clunking feeling (I have no sound) goes away when the muscles are stronger.
